Music Magazine Research

Displayed on this page I have my music magazine research.Each one of these magazines have a diverse design compared to one another.Different colours are usedThe text displayed is dissimilar and they all have a completely different hip hop artist displayed on the cover with the layout that best suits their character. The headers as you can see is always behind the artist for the magazine allows the musician to stand out much more let alone the reader who is familiar with the header no longer needs to take much interest of it anymore.

Page 4: Media studies - final media product

Media Studies 4

Double Page Spread ResearchThis is my double page spread research:•As you can see the layout for these pictures are completely opposite for they both have the image of an artist on different sides of the pages. However it is common to have the image on the right hand side for the audience to take in the image of who the artist is so they can look forward to reading about their interview / career on the left.

•The magazine on the top is a lot more professional then the bottom double page spread for the quality is much better however the bottom design has decided to go for the simple look: white background full shot image of the artist and text on the right.

Primary Target AudienceMy primary target audience due to my genre which is Hip Hop would be:Gender: Young Males and Older Males  Age: 16 - 40  Social Background: Working Class, Middle Class, Still in Education, Males looking to make it into the Hip Hop industry

Secondary AudienceGender: Teenage females  Age: 16 - 25  Social Background: Middle Class, Education, Teenage Mothers To attract my target audience my header needs to be something inspirational which they can look to as a sign of hope or something that will keep them interested in the magazine, a header that shows that the magazine is Hip Hop but something that gives everybody an opportunity in entering the Hip Hop industry, or from the information on the front of the magazine, headers that really catch their attention.

Two Step flow

Two artist; Wiz Khalifa & Tyga being mentioned in the magazine so the reader will be intrigued by the story on pg 10.

The mention of a track being released with Wiz Khalifa suggest that Wiz Khalifa fans will definitely purchase the magazine

The Nicki Minaj ‘teaser pics’ implies that the male audience will have interest for this and the mention of other popular hip hop music artist will bring about dedicate fans to buy it

The two step flow applied to my own front cover magazine and my contents and double page spread are crucial ideas that needed to be applied to my media products to make the reader want to buy the magazine more.
